Transaction 560893e59f2de8051c18668e2aa8f7666b828389e5211842523c65b3956dada0
2 Input
2 Outputs
- 560893e59f2de8051c18668e2aa8f7666b828389e5211842523c65b3956dada0:0
- 560893e59f2de8051c18668e2aa8f7666b828389e5211842523c65b3956dada0:1
value 11861455
address 35d9UPjWhdpbE7T2r6msaNjkpoTDJi8HAt
value 1375679
address 1Awa3Ww6kwAnprbUVay7Lg1AWFc9r1wS5D